From Physical Casinos to Digital Platforms

Historically, gaming was confined to physical venues where players faced limitations related to geography, operating hours, and socio-economic barriers. The advent of the internet opened opportunities for virtual casinos, allowing users to access a wide variety of games from the comfort of their homes. Early online gambling sites primarily offered simple digital versions of slot machines and poker, but soon expanded into live dealer games, sports betting, and eSports betting, embracing a wider gambling ecosystem.

The Role of Technology in Enhancing User Experience

Modern online casino platforms leverage cutting-edge technology such as high-definition streaming, dynamic user interfaces, and advanced random number generators (RNGs) to create a seamless and fair gaming experience. Mobile optimization has further increased accessibility, enabling players to participate from smartphones and tablets. Blockchain integration introduces transparency and security, appealing especially to tech-savvy audiences who prioritize provably fair gaming and privacy.

Legal and Regulatory Challenges

Despite the widespread growth of online gambling, legal challenges persist. Different jurisdictions have varying laws regarding online betting, leading to a patchwork of regulated and unregulated markets. This has encouraged operators to seek licensing from recognized authorities such as Malta Gaming Authority, UK Gambling Commission, and Gibraltar Regulatory Authority. Regulatory oversight aims to protect consumers and ensure fair play, fostering a trustworthy environment for gambling enthusiasts worldwide.
